Output 1324d7156c2dc6ce5cebb74c3c4f1c1363c9e20c9ef3c8c54a07e59868638681: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8dbc1458c5198670aea41f23f937d5a23db018 OP_EQUAL
address
372cuZviiEgWtYC23azmo3U6A9nxc1h8J9
transaction
1324d7156c2dc6ce5cebb74c3c4f1c1363c9e20c9ef3c8c54a07e59868638681
spent
true